2013-09-23 3 views
1

У меня есть эта проблема:Liferay пользователя экспорта в Ldap: Пароль политик

Я позволил Liferay для импорта и экспорта пользователей сервера/к OpenLDAP.

Когда я создаю пользователь в Liferay я получаю эту страницу:

enter image description here

Итак, у меня есть создать новый пользователь и Liferay присвоил ему пароль (3zbPk6KA).

Но если я попытаюсь войти в систему с новым пользователем (и сгенерированным паролем), я получаю сообщение об ошибке с неправильными учетными данными. В сервере LDAP можно увидеть новую учетную запись, но, соответствующий пароль, кажется, отличается от порождена Liferay ..

В Java консоли я прочитал это предупреждение:

14:20:15,882 WARN [http-bio-8080-exec-6][LDAPAuth:208] Passwords do not match for userDN cn=myUser,ou=users,dc=myProject,dc=com 

Некоторые предложения?

ответ

0

Если бы эта проблема тоже. Какова ваша ценность для политики паролей Ldap и какова ваша версия для жизни?

Я думаю, что у вас есть 2 варианта:

  1. политики паролей Отключить Ldap, и если ваша версия Liferay не ошибка на экспорт автогенерируемые пароли нового пользователя, Ваш сценарий должен работать. Кроме того, вам нужно будет создать патч/крючок, который отправит этот пароль LDAP
  2. Включить политику паролей LDAP, установить фиксированный пароль по умолчанию LDAP и подключить процесс входа в систему, чтобы вы сообщали новому зарегистрированному пользователю (Экранное сообщение + подтверждение электронной почты) по ее первоначальному паролю. Обратите внимание, что по-прежнему существует проблема безопасности из-за фиксированного пароля, так как кто-то может создавать учетные записи для других пользователей, если он знает свои электронные письма и пытается зарегистрироваться до них.
+0

Я использую Liferay-портал-6.1.1-се-GA2 и я отключил опцию пароля политики LDAP – Safari

0

Вы должны пометку «обязательный» в ControlPanel → Портал → Конфигурация → autenticathion → LDAP для ди

0

Я не знаю, почему этот конкретный сценарий не работает. Я использовал Liferay 6.1 и знаю, что существует ряд ошибок с функцией LDAP версии 6.1. Проблема, с которой я столкнулась, заключалась в том, что проверка «Использовать политику паролей LDAP» привела к созданию пользователя без пароля.

Однако, если ваш пароль создается в Liferay, вы можете отключить экспорт в Liferay LDAP wizard и программно экспортировать пользователей с помощью перехвата Java LDAP. Я должен был это сделать, и он исправил ряд подобных вопросов для меня.

Ссылка является ниже http://abhirampal.com/2014/12/20/liferay-ldap-export-to-active-directory-disabled-user-bug/

Смежные вопросы